3. How to Fix "Sage 50 Cannot Connect to Database" Error



This error usually occurs with network-based setups in which Sage data is hosted on a server. The error means Sage 50 cannot connect to your database's connection manager.



Common Causes:





Host server shut down





Windows firewall blocks Sage ports





Connection Manager is not working





Incorrect data path mapping





Affected .SAJ and .SAI files





Steps to Resolve the Issue:



Ensure the Server is ON and Connected to the Network


Make a Database Connection Manager restart
To the server computer





Open Services.msc





Locate Sage 50 Database Connection Manager





Click Restart







Check the File Options for Shared Access
Your File folder of the company must be:
It is shared
and accessible by a read/write permit



Disable VPN or Third-Party Firewalls


Verify Correct Data Path on All Systems





Compare server and local paths





Be sure that all mapped drives have the same letter
(e.g., Z:SageData)





Ping the Server Open Command Prompt


Type: ping [server name]







If packets don't work, the issue is a network related.



4. How to Fix Data Corruption Errors in Sage 50



Data corruption is typically a result of Sage 50 closes unexpectedly due to:





Power Failure





Sudden computer shutdown





Network interruption





Storage configurations that are not correct





Using cloud-sync applications (like OneDrive or Google Drive)





How to Repair Corrupted Data:





Open Sage File Maintenance - Check Information
Sage can search for errors and find out the cause.





Use the Repair Software
This is an attempt at automatized correction of minor data inconsistencies.





Restore Backup
If the corruption is severe:





Go to File - Restore





Select the cleanest backup file







Move the Data files onto a Local Drive Temporarily
Fixing might fail if the company's data file is on a slow network.





Use cloud storage to store live images
Always store information that is active locally, or on an individual server.





5. How to Fix Sage 50 Installation or Update Errors



Sage 50 may display errors at the time of installation or upgrading due to damaged or missing components, system files, or restricted permissions.



Steps to Fix Installation Issues:





Start Installer with an Administrator
It gives the system full permission to modify files.





disable antivirus during installation
The antivirus software may stop installer scripts.



Install Required Microsoft Components: .NET Framework


Visual C++ Redistributables





SQL Express (if required)







Clear Tempo file
Clear temporary installation files by using the command %temp *.





Test Disk Space
Make sure you have at least 2 GB free room on the installation drive.





Restart the PC after installation
It helps ensure the services are running correctly.
